Finding the Right Fundraising Opportunity
![]() |
Fundraisers are essential to schools, churches, and charities. Without them, these organizations wouldn't have the funds they needed. If you're planning a fundraiser for a nonprofit organization, it's crucial to choose the right fundraising opportunity. There are so many different ways to raise funds, it's sometimes difficult to choose which one is right for you. Here are some tips to help you find the perfect fundraising opportunity:
Look at what other organizations are doing. For example, many schools do well with candy and food fundraisers. Chocolate bars, lollipops, cookies, pizza, pasta, coffee, tea, and cocoa are just a few of the foodstuffs that groups are selling for their fundraisers.
If selling food isn't for you, then there are other products you can sell. Some fundraising opportunities offer coupon books, scratch cards, collectibles, gift wrap, scented candles and more. If you're selling items for a school fundraiser, be sure to get the input of your best salespeople – the students! If the students like what they're selling, they're going to be more enthusiastic and work harder to meet their goals.
When looking for a fundraising opportunity, be sure to deal with a respected company that has a long history of providing nonprofit organizations with quality products. For maximum results, choose products that offer a profit of at least 50% per sale.
Maybe you don't want to sell anything. In that case, why not try a fun event like a car wash, carnival, or casino night? Or, you could do what many large charities have done and hold a marathon or walkathon. The athletes simply solicit donations from sponsors prior to the event.
When it comes to deciding whether or not you want to sell an item or have an event, take into consideration the type of organization the fundraiser will benefit. Historically, candy and merchandise sales do well in schools, events work well for churches, and marathons are often lucrative for larger national organizations.
One way to locate the most profitable fundraising opportunity for your organization is to use the services of a fundraising consultant whose job it is to advise you and assist with many aspects of the fundraising process.
